60 /*
61 * Stubs for system calls and facilities not included in the system.
62 */

81 /*
82 * Nonexistent system call-- signal process (may want to handle it). Flag
83 * error in case process won't see signal immediately (blocked or ignored).
84 */
85 #ifndef PTRACE
86 __weak_alias(sys_ptrace,sys_nosys);
87 #endif /* PTRACE */
88
89 /*
90 * ktrace stubs. ktruser() goes to enosys as we want to fail the syscall,
91 * but not kill the process: utrace() is a debugging feature.
92 */
93 #ifndef KTRACE
94 __weak_alias(ktr_csw,nullop); /* Probes */
95 __weak_alias(ktr_emul,nullop);
96 __weak_alias(ktr_geniov,nullop);
97 __weak_alias(ktr_genio,nullop);
98 __weak_alias(ktr_mibio,nullop);
99 __weak_alias(ktr_namei,nullop);
100 __weak_alias(ktr_namei2,nullop);
101 __weak_alias(ktr_psig,nullop);
102 __weak_alias(ktr_saupcall,nullop);
103 __weak_alias(ktr_syscall,nullop);
104 __weak_alias(ktr_sysret,nullop);
105 __weak_alias(ktr_kuser,nullop);
106 __weak_alias(ktr_mmsg,nullop);
107 __weak_alias(ktr_mib,nullop);
108 __weak_alias(ktr_mool,nullop);
109 __weak_alias(ktr_execarg,nullop);
110 __weak_alias(ktr_execenv,nullop);
111
112 __weak_alias(sys_fktrace,sys_nosys); /* Syscalls */
113 __weak_alias(sys_ktrace,sys_nosys);
114 __weak_alias(sys_utrace,sys_nosys);
115
116 int ktrace_on; /* Misc */
117 __weak_alias(ktruser,enosys);
118 __weak_alias(ktr_point,nullop);
119 #endif /* KTRACE */
120
121 /*
122 * Scheduler activations system calls. These need to remain, even when
123 * KERN_SA isn't defined, until libc's major version is bumped.
124 */
125 #if !defined(KERN_SA)
126 __strong_alias(sys_sa_register,sys_nosys);
127 __strong_alias(sys_sa_stacks,sys_nosys);
128 __strong_alias(sys_sa_enable,sys_nosys);
129 __strong_alias(sys_sa_setconcurrency,sys_nosys);
130 __strong_alias(sys_sa_yield,sys_nosys);
131 __strong_alias(sys_sa_preempt,sys_nosys);
132 __strong_alias(sys_sa_unblockyield,sys_nosys);
133 #endif

135 /*
136 * Stubs for architectures that do not support kernel preemption.
137 */
138 #ifndef __HAVE_PREEMPTION
139 bool
140 cpu_kpreempt_enter(uintptr_t where, int s)
141 {
142
143 return false;
144 }
145
146 void
147 cpu_kpreempt_exit(uintptr_t where)
148 {
149
150 }
151
152 bool
153 cpu_kpreempt_disabled(void)
154 {
155
156 return true;
157 }
158 #else
159 # ifndef MULTIPROCESSOR
160 # error __HAVE_PREEMPTION requires MULTIPROCESSOR
161 # endif
162 #endif /* !__HAVE_PREEMPTION */
163
164 /* ARGSUSED */
165 int
166 sys_nosys(struct lwp *l, const void *v, register_t *retval)
167 {
168
169 mutex_enter(proc_lock);
170 psignal(l->l_proc, SIGSYS);
171 mutex_exit(proc_lock);
172 return ENOSYS;
173 }
174
175 /*
176 * Unsupported device function (e.g. writing to read-only device).
177 */
178 int
179 enodev(void)
180 {
181
182 return (ENODEV);
183 }
184
185 /*
186 * Unconfigured device function; driver not configured.
187 */
188 int
189 enxio(void)
190 {
191
192 return (ENXIO);
193 }
194
195 /*
196 * Unsupported ioctl function.
197 */
198 int
199 enoioctl(void)
200 {
201
202 return (ENOTTY);
203 }
204
205 /*
206 * Unsupported system function.
207 * This is used for an otherwise-reasonable operation
208 * that is not supported by the current system binary.
209 */
210 int
211 enosys(void)
212 {
213
214 return (ENOSYS);
215 }
216
217 /*
218 * Return error for operation not supported
219 * on a specific object or file type.
220 */
221 int
222 eopnotsupp(void)
223 {
224
225 return (EOPNOTSUPP);
226 }
227
228 /*
229 * Generic null operation, always returns success.
230 */
231 /*ARGSUSED*/
232 int
233 nullop(void *v)
234 {
235
236 return (0);
237 }
238
